FAU head coach Lane Kiffin’s immediate future has undergone some significant changes in the past few days.
First, it was that Arkansas had him on their radar, and Kiffin was being considered as a legit contender for the Razorbacks job. Anticipating Kiffin vs. Saban, and Kiffin vs. Gus match ups in SEC West play certainly had some serious appeal for a lot of folks. The Razorbacks wanted to make a splash with their hire, someone the fan base could rally around, and Kiffin certainly checked both those boxes.
Last night we shared information that FAU was preparing an offer with the intent to keep him. Sources had told FootballScoop, even if Arkansas were to offer him the job, it was not a foregone conclusion that Lane would take the opportunity as he certainly values his setup in Boca.
Until recently, it felt as if Lane’s options were Arkansas or FAU.
Late last night we began to hear of a change. Something was up. Word we were getting from sources had swung to, “Well, it looks like Lane is going to move on.” What changed? Did Arkansas go big, or did a new player step up?
The whisper is that Ole Miss is now a major player in the pursuit of Lane Kiffin’s services.
Kiffin’s Owls play UAB Saturday at 1:30 ET for the Conference USA title. “Then things get interesting” one source told FootballScoop.
Per football scoop
